TBI: Q3 Outlook And Margin Shift Will Shape Next Phase

Analysts have raised their price target on TrueBlue to $9.50 from $7.00 after updating models to reflect better than expected Q2 results and guidance that indicated a potential inflection in the business.

What's in the News for TrueBlue

  • TrueBlue issued earnings guidance for the third quarter of 2026, providing investors with updated expectations for the near term. Source: Key Developments.
  • The company expects Q3 2026 revenue growth in a range of 7% to 11% year over year. Source: Key Developments.
  • Management highlighted what it describes as improved trends across all three segments and sustained growth in skilled businesses as context for the Q3 2026 outlook. Source: Key Developments.

Valuation Changes for TrueBlue

  • Fair Value: Updated to $9.50 from $7.00, representing a significant increase in the assessed value per share.
  • Discount Rate: Adjusted slightly lower to 8.35% from 8.69%, reflecting a modest change in the required return used in the valuation model.
  • Revenue Growth: Revised to 2.97% from 4.41%, indicating a more cautious assumption for TrueBlue's future sales growth.
  • Net Profit Margin: Updated to 5.94% from 2.72%, representing a material uplift in expected profitability levels.
  • Future P/E: Reset to 3.53x from 5.61x, indicating a lower valuation multiple applied to projected earnings.

Catalysts

About TrueBlue

TrueBlue provides specialized and on-demand staffing, recruitment process outsourcing and workforce solutions across sectors such as energy, transportation and health care.

What are the underlying business or industry changes driving this perspective?

  • Although energy sector revenue more than doubled in the quarter and PeopleReady grew 17%, the heavier mix toward lower margin renewable energy work and related pass through travel costs may limit the benefit to gross margin and earnings if this mix shift persists.
  • While the commercial driver business delivered its fifth consecutive quarter of double digit revenue growth and is taking share in transportation, persistent softness in broader freight volumes or additional site shutdowns at key clients could restrict overall PeopleManagement revenue and segment profit expansion.
  • Although the acquisition of Healthcare Staffing Professionals and entry into additional states aligns with long term demand in U.S. health care, slower than expected hiring volumes or pricing pressure from hospital systems could dampen the contribution to PeopleSolutions revenue and segment margins.
  • While TrueBlue is investing heavily in its proprietary digital platforms, including JobStack price estimates and enterprise wide enhancements, higher software depreciation now reported in cost of services and the risk of slower client adoption could weigh on reported gross margin and delay improvement in EBITDA.
  • Although SG&A declined 8% while total revenue reached US$431 million with 13% growth, future reinvestment in local sales capacity and the need to support new growth channels and partnerships may cap further net margin improvement if revenue momentum slows.

Assumptions

How have these above catalysts been quantified?

  • This narrative explores a more pessimistic perspective on TrueBlue compared to the consensus, based on a Fair Value that aligns with the bearish cohort of analysts.
  • The bearish analysts are assuming TrueBlue's revenue will grow by 3.0% annually over the next 3 years.
  • The bearish analysts assume that profit margins will increase from -3.3% today to 5.9% in 3 years time.
  • The bearish analysts expect earnings to reach $109.7 million (and earnings per share of $3.67) by about August 2029, up from -$56.6 million today. The analysts are largely in agreement about this estimate.
  • In order for the above numbers to justify the price target of the more bearish analyst cohort, the company would need to trade at a PE ratio of 3.5x on those 2029 earnings, up from -5.3x today. This future PE is lower than the current PE for the US Professional Services industry at 22.6x.
  • The bearish analysts expect the number of shares outstanding to grow by 1.82% per year for the next 3 years.
  • To value all of this in today's terms, we will use a discount rate of 8.35%, as per the Simply Wall St company report.

Risks

What could happen that would invalidate this narrative?

  • The energy vertical and renewable projects are growing from a lower margin base, and a continued tilt toward lower margin work with pass through travel costs could keep gross margin under pressure and limit the flow through of higher revenue into earnings.
  • Health care staffing and RPO are tied to hiring volumes that management describes as subdued. A prolonged period of cautious customer sentiment or slower hiring recovery in health care, engineering and technology could weigh on revenue growth and delay any improvement in net margins.
  • The company reported a net loss of US$2 million and is relying on cost cuts and operating leverage to improve profitability. Any need to reinvest more heavily in sales capacity or technology than expected could restrict the pace of earnings improvement and keep adjusted EBITDA modest.
  • TrueBlue operates in a highly fragmented staffing market where clients are described as price sensitive. Persistent pricing pressure from smaller competitors or cost conscious customers could limit pricing power and constrain both revenue and gross margin.
  • Higher software depreciation is now recorded in cost of services, and potential slower adoption of digital platforms or sales initiatives could keep reported gross margin and earnings under strain even if long-term demand for compliant, specialized staffing solutions remains supportive.

Valuation

How have all the factors above been brought together to estimate a fair value?

  • The assumed bearish price target for TrueBlue is $9.5, which represents up to two standard deviations below the consensus price target of $9.75. This valuation is based on what can be assumed as the expectations of TrueBlue's future earnings growth, profit margins and other risk factors from analysts on the more bearish end of the spectrum.
  • In order for you to agree with the more bearish analyst cohort, you'd need to believe that by 2029, revenues will be $1.8 billion, earnings will come to $109.7 million, and it would be trading on a PE ratio of 3.5x, assuming you use a discount rate of 8.4%.
  • Given the current share price of $9.9, the analyst price target of $9.5 is 4.2% lower. The relatively low difference between the current share price and the analyst consensus price target indicates that they believe on average, the company is fairly priced.
